摘要
It is an instrument including an optical collimating element (30) having a focal distance, a point light source (25 - 27) with a wavelength of between 700 and 1000 nm, a diameter less than or equal to the 50th of the focal distance and arranged to a first focus of the collimation device for the light beam (20) becomes a collimated light, a back-scattering device (12), a support in order to receive an ophthalmic lens (14), with said collimating element, the support and back-scattering device which are disposed so that the collimated light beam reaches the location (15) of the lens in which are present in the microengravings, a member of the processing of images (32) and a member for capturing images (31) connected to said processing unit and comprising a lens (35) disposed at a second focus of said collimating element, which is developed in order to provide the device for processing the images of the back-scattering device in order to identify and localize said microengravings.
